Problem
Current cellular telephones lack a modular solution for e-cigarette functionality that integrates with existing phone designs, failing to provide effective tracking and control of e-cigarette use for smoking cessation while leveraging phone power and processing capabilities.
Innovation Solution
A modular smartphone component with an e-cigarette module that includes a heater tank, microcontroller, and data interface, allowing for electrical interconnection with the phone, power management, and user interface features like tracking and usage monitoring, compatible with various e-cigarette hardware and designed for easy attachment and concealment.
Engineering Contradictions & Design Principles
Engineering Contradiction Analysis
1Volume of moving object
If e-cigarette functionality is integrated into a modular smartphone component, then the device becomes compact and leverages smartphone power/processing capabilities, but the device complexity increases due to multiple connection interfaces and components
Solution Approach 1:
The modular e-cigarette component is designed to interface with universal smartphone connection standards (such as USB-C or Lightning connectors) that provide both power and data communication. This allows a single module design to work across multiple smartphone models, reducing the complexity of designing unique integration solutions for each device while maintaining compact form factor.
Solution Approach 2:
The e-cigarette system is divided into separate modular components: a reusable control module that interfaces with the smartphone, and replaceable consumable cartridges containing the heating element and liquid reservoir. This segmentation allows the complex electronic control portion to be integrated with the smartphone while keeping the vaporization function separate and replaceable, thereby managing overall system complexity.
2Loss of information
If the module provides data interface with the cell phone for monitoring e-cigarette use, then smoking cessation tracking is enabled, but the ease of operation is reduced due to setup and synchronization requirements
Solution Approach 1:
The modular e-cigarette component automatically performs data synchronization with the smartphone application whenever connected. Usage information, cartridge identification, and consumption data are transmitted autonomously without requiring manual intervention from the user, thus maintaining ease of operation while enabling comprehensive usage tracking.
Solution Approach 2:
The system pre-configures tracking parameters and user profiles before actual e-cigarette usage begins. During initial setup, the user provides basic information and the application pre-establishes tracking metrics, so that during normal use, data is automatically captured and logged without requiring user action, thereby maintaining operational simplicity.
3Ease of operation
If the interface socket is made swiveling to provide comfortable fit and desired angle of inhalation, then ease of operation is improved, but the device complexity increases due to moving mechanical parts
Solution Approach 1:
The interface socket is designed with a swiveling mechanism that allows the mouthpiece to rotate to different angles. This dynamic adjustment capability enables users to find the most comfortable inhalation angle, improving ease of operation. The swivel mechanism uses simple friction-based or spring-loaded joints that add minimal complexity while providing continuous angular adjustment.
4Ease of operation
If the module is interconnected through magnetic coupling for easy removal and replacement, then ease of operation is improved, but the reliability of electrical connection may be compromised
Solution Approach 1:
The connection system merges two mechanisms: magnetic coupling for initial attachment and alignment, and a mechanical latch or snap-fit feature for secure locking. The magnetic force guides the module into proper alignment during attachment, while the mechanical element ensures reliable electrical contact and prevents accidental disconnection, thereby combining the ease of magnetic attachment with the reliability of mechanical connection.
